SOC 304H Hon Social Problems

A critical, topical consideration of many of the�most serious problems besetting society today. The�course examines causes, consequences,�interconnections, and solutions to various social�problems from diverse points of view. The emphasis�may vary according to current issues and student�interests. Common themes include: inequality and�poverty; morality and sexuality; community and�criminality; abuse of persons and substances;�mental and physical health and care; population�and ecology; changes in age, gender, class, and�race relations.
